Houston City Council greenlights investment in 25 neighborhood parks

A public-private partnership aims to bring new parks to various areas. This initiative involves the construction of 25 parks through a collaboration between the city and a local government corporation. Mayor John Whitmire views this as a significant investment in parks.
Further details about the project are available, including a video story. The initiative is part of a larger effort called Let's Play Houston .
The city's leader believes all neighborhoods should have a great park for residents to enjoy. This project is considered a major investment in neighborhood parks.
